Thomas E. SargentMarch 17, 1950 - Nov. 26, 2021 St. Patrick's Day has always been a special day to celebrate for the family of Thomas Ernest Sargent, marking the day he was born in 1950 in St. Helens, Ore., to Betty Lou (Grubb) and Frank H. Sargent. Tom grew up loving baseball and his mother's...
